“in a Long-term Prospective Longitudinal Multi-Center Study”
“statin use was associated with more than double the risk of converting to dementia”
Statins caused “posterior cingulate metabolic decline”
“We conducted a 12-week prospective, nonblinded
study using a 6-week withdrawal phase followed by a
6-week rechallenge phase with statins”
A prospective study tested the cognitive effects of statins. It used a designed that tested cognitive function while on statins, after withdrawing from them and after reinitiating their use.
Conclusion: “found an improvement in cognition with discontinuation of statins and worsening with rechallenge. Statins may adversely affect cognition”
Conflict of interest disclosures:: The various authors had received funding and were employees of half a dozen different drug corporations.
Methods:
“A retrospective cohort study compared new users of statin medications with unexposed individuals”
“In addition, a second control group of patients receiving nonstatin LLDs”
“A secondary case-crossover study was undertaken to eliminate confounding… (using) intermittent exposure”
The study looked at acute decline in memory, and memory loss.
Results:
Statin users compared with matched nonusers of any LLD’s had an increased OR 1.23 (1.18-1.28)
In contrast nonstatin LLDs users had a statistical insignificant .96 OR
Statins with stronger strengths had “increased OR associated with the most lipophilic statin”
There was a dose dependent relationship with higher doses following more memory loss “A dose-response relationship was observed”
